Original British 18 inch x 12 inch 16 page illustrated Pressbook for the 1937 Tim Whelan Drama FAREWELL AGAIN starring Flora Robson, Leslie Banks, Robert Newton, Sebastian Shaw, Rene Ray, Anthony Bushell, Leonora Corbett, Eliot Makeham, Martita Hunt, Edward Lexy, Maire O’Neill, Wally Patch, Alf Goddard, John Laurie, Jerry Verno and William Hartnell.

Carrying the same call to preparedness as “Fire Over England” (both were produced by Erich Pommer and scripted by Clemence Dane), this is about a troopship bringing men home on leave after five years army service in India. Trouble stirs when orders require an immediate return to duty, but, after six hours in port during which all the carefully planted domestic problems and heartbreaks get a cursory airing, everybody nobly buckles to. Quite warmly praised at the time, but the class attitudes accepted as perfectly normal, the officers, suffering stoically, soothe other-rank grumbles with a patronising pat on the head; the gentry cavort over cocktails and dancing in the saloon while the lower orders huddle like squalid sardines below decks, are positively cringe-making. No wonder Churchill and the Tories were elected out after World War II.

The Pressbook is in good folded condition with superb posters designed by Kupfer Sachs displayed on the inside back page. Sachs also designed posters for THINGS TO COME.

There is also a 5 inch x 7 inch 4 page herald tacked inside.

There are five cuts in the pressbook; pages 3/4 have a 5 1/2 inch x 1 inch cut through text on both sides (an extended 3 inch tear has resulted from this); pages 9/10 have a 7 inch x 3 inch cut through an ad block on one side and text on the other, a 4 inch x 2 inch cut through 2 ad blocks on one side and text on the other a 4 1/2 inch x 3 inch cut through an ad block on one side and text on the other; pages 11/12 have a 5 inch x 4 inch cut through text on both sides and a 4 inch x 2 inch cut through text on both sides.
